Abstract

Relatively expensive building elements are used for fastening glass panes (5) of different thicknesses. The new building element is to permit a reduction in the number of parts required, which simplifies mounting and storage. Two upper and lower strips (1,2) which can fit into one another are provided, optionally supplemented by spacers (9). A cover profile can be attached to the upper strip (1) and a collecting profile for condensation water can be attached to the lower strip (2). The building element is suitable for prefabricated construction, e.g. for roofing, greenhouse, solar and winter garden construction. <IMAGE>

Claims (4)

  1. Building element for fastening glass panes (5), which is composed of a plurality of parts and which has a lower strip (2), a spacer piece (9) insertable into this lower strip in a locking manner and an upper strip (1) insertable into the spacer piece, the glass panes being retained between the upper and lower strips by means of gaskets (6) arranged in clearances (7) on the longitudinal edges (8) of the upper and lower strips (1, 2), characterised in that the region (3) formed on the lower strip (2) for receiving the spacer piece (9) and the region formed an the spacer piece (9) for receiving the upper strip (1) are of identical cross-section, in that two thicknesses are provided for the gaskets (6), and in that the upper and lower strips (1, 2) can be fixed relative to one another by means of a screw connection (13).
  2. Construction kit according to Claim 1, characterised in that a covering section (10) can be slipped onto the upper strip (1).
  3. Construction kit according to Claim 1 or 2, characterised in that there is a condensation collecting section (12) which can be fastened to the lower strip (2).
  4. Construction kit according to Claim 1, 2 or 3, characterised in that the upper strip (1) and the lower strip (2) consist of aluminium.
